{ lib
, fetchFromGitHub
, fetchpatch
, meson
, python3Packages
, ninja
, gtk3
, wrapGAppsHook
, glib
, gtksourceview4
, itstool
, gettext
, pango
, gdk-pixbuf
, libsecret
, gobject-introspection
, xvfb-run
}:
python3Packages.buildPythonApplication rec {
pname = "gtg";
version = "0.6";
src = fetchFromGitHub {
owner = "getting-things-gnome";
repo = "gtg";
rev = "v${version}";
sha256 = "sha256-O8qBD92P2g8QrBdMXa6j0Ozk+W80Ny5yk0KNTy7ekfE=";
};
nativeBuildInputs = [
meson
ninja
itstool
gettext
wrapGAppsHook
gobject-introspection
];
buildInputs = [
glib
gtk3
gtksourceview4
pango
gdk-pixbuf
libsecret
];
propagatedBuildInputs = with python3Packages; [
pycairo
pygobject3
lxml
gst-python
liblarch
caldav
];
nativeCheckInputs = with python3Packages; [
nose
mock
xvfb-run
pytest
];
preBuild = ''
export HOME="$TMP"
'';
format = "other";
checkPhase = "xvfb-run pytest ../tests/";
meta = with lib; {
description = " A personal tasks and TODO-list items organizer";
mainProgram = "gtg";
longDescription = ''
"Getting Things GNOME" (GTG) is a personal tasks and ToDo list organizer inspired by the "Getting Things Done" (GTD) methodology.
GTG is intended to help you track everything you need to do and need to know, from small tasks to large projects.
'';
homepage = "https://wiki.gnome.org/Apps/GTG";
downloadPage = "https://github.com/getting-things-gnome/gtg/releases";
license = licenses.gpl3Plus;
maintainers = with maintainers; [ oyren ];
platforms = platforms.linux;
};
}
